Groomed access to Maine's 14,000-mile trail network with trailside cabins & lodging, full resort with restaurant, brewery & hot tub, along with snowmobile rentals, tours & plenty of room for trailers. Northern Outdoors is designed for snowmobilers by snowmobilers, with its own Kennebec River Pub & Brewery on-site and the largest selection of private cabins with groomed access to the trails. Maine’s 14,000 miles of groomed snowmobile trails are regarded as some of the finest in the country, and the popular Forks Area Trails Network connects you to it all right from the front door of your cabin and the Northern Outdoors lodge. Northern Outdoors' expert grooming crew does consistent, professional trail grooming using three Tucker Sno-cat groomers located on-site. Frequent snowmobile trail conditions updates are just a click away during the season. Northern Outdoors is known for consistently delivering on some of the best-groomed trails in the state and all of New England. Just a few of the amenities available at the resort: a big-timbered, cozy main lodge; 2 bedroom to 4 bedroom log cabins; a full-service restaurant; microbrewery (featured on the Maine Beer Trail; guided and self-guided tours; snowmobile rentals; onsite gas; free park & ride lot; and plenty of supplies and services. Northern Outdoors is located 4 hours from Boston, MA, and 2 ½ hours from Portland, ME, on Route 201, The Old Canada Road National Scenic Byway in The Forks, Maine.
